Timezone in Barchel
Barchel is located in the Europe/Berlin timezone, which has a standard UTC offset of +1 hour. During daylight saving time, which typically begins on the last Sunday in March and ends on the last Sunday in October, the offset changes to UTC+2 hours. This means that from late March to late October, the clocks are set forward by one hour, allowing for longer daylight in the evenings.
